## Support

Hot-reloading in Kindlewick mostly Just Works: edit the config, the watcher picks it up, no restart needed. If a reload silently fails, check the validation log first — nine times out of ten it's a stray comma. Still stuck? Ping the #kindlewick channel, or for anything weird or urgent, drop a note to the platform crew at the address below.

escalation mailbox, bafog-fafog: ulador@paliqlabs.internal

Handover: Password Reset Revamp — from Darla to Venn. Plugin authors, note that Quillgate's reset flow now issues single-use tokens scoped per plugin namespace, so your hooks must re-register after every deploy. Legacy callbacks are tolerated until the Marrow release but log deprecation warnings. Test against the staging realm, never production. If you lose access to the staging vault, use the recovery passphrase below.

strongbox words: istwyn-normir-silwyn-ulaius-istwyn

Subject: DR drill Thursday — fan-out backpressure

On-call: during the Hartwell drill we'll throttle the Plumeline notifier to force queue backpressure. Expect alert storms around 14:00; suppress per the runbook. Verify the dead-letter drain recovers within ten minutes. If the standby broker needs manual unseal, enter the recovery passphrase below.

unlock words, bawip-bawip: rusiel-caseth-norax-tameth-zorvan-silax-frador-oliath-caswyn-noveth-keliel-gilmir-pelox

// Barcode scanner bridge for the Stockhopper warehouse app.
// Heads up: the Zebraline scanners talk to our internal Scanrelay
// service, not directly to inventory. Don't skip the handshake call
// or every scan gets queued as "unverified" and ops will ping you.
// Timeouts are set low on purpose; the scan floor has flaky wifi.
// The client below authenticates to Scanrelay using this key.

app token of fahaf-yafof = kto2_sf

Handover: Exportron retry queue

Hi Mira — handing over the failed-export retries. Exports that hit a timeout land in the retry queue and get three attempts with backoff; after that they're parked and need a manual requeue from the admin panel. Watch for customers reporting duplicates — that usually means a double requeue. The current retry settings are as follows.

settings of bajog-fawig:
oliael:
  log_level: warn
  metrics_host: metrics.oliael.zemvarsys.internal
  pin: 0267
  pool_size: 32